Driver of stolen vehicle faces multiple charges

Multiple criminal complaints are being filed against a 32-year-old Hickman resident who was stopped in Ceres on Wednesday afternoon, March 16 by Officer Ross Bays.

Bays was on patrol at 1:42 p.m. in the area of Hatch Road and Herndon Avenue when he spotted a maroon-colored Dodge pickup reported stolen. When the officer activated his red lights, the suspect, Stephanie Howrey, 32, of Hickman, pulled over into the parking lot of the Dollar Store. Howrey was found in possession of shaved vehicle keys, ammunition and drug paraphernalia.

Howrey was arrested and booked for possession of a stolen vehicle, possession of stolen property, being a felon in possession of ammunition, possession of burglary tools, possession of methamphetamine and possession of drug paraphernalia. As she was being booked in the County Jail, Howrey was found with an additional baggie of methamphetamine concealed in her bra, which netted her final charge of attempting to smuggle a controlled substance into the jail.
